Long life for general-purpose relay
family

Omron's general-purpose relay family offers a wider range of options with rack mounting versions and a push-to-test facility.

High switching power, up to 10A on single-pole models, is provided in a space-saving unit just 29mm high and 13 x 29mm in footprint.

For high-density applications, the relays are specified for 8mm creepage distance and 8mm air clearance.

Panel- or rack-mounted, their pluggable design ensures simple exchange and service, bolstered by a test button to verify dependable operation.

Electrical life expectancy is rated for 100,000 operations minimum, and the relays carry a range of international approvals including UK 508, CSA 22.2, SEV, TUV and VDE0435.

Single- and double-pole versions are available, in SPDT or DPDT contact forms and optionally with bifurcated crossbar connect.

Coil rating options are 12 to 240V AC and 5 to 100V DC.
